Chaweng Beach (หาดเฉวง)
Chaweng Beach (หาดเฉวง) stretches over 6 kilometers along the eastern shore of Koh Samui, adjacent to vibrant areas filled with shops and eateries. Historically, this beach has attracted travelers since the 1960s, evolving from a little-known destination to one of Thailand’s most popular tourist spots. Known for its soft white sand and clear waters, Chaweng Beach serves as a primary hub for sunbathing, swimming, and water sports like jet skiing and parasailing. In December, expect to see a lively atmosphere as holiday festivities bring visitors from around the world. Along with beach activities, visitors can enjoy local dining options and vibrant nightlife options, making it a central point for entertainment on the island.
